Title : 
Physics hypercumulation and comdined shaped charges
         
        
            Author : 
Minin, V.F. ; Minin, O.V. ; Minin, I.V.
         
        
            Author_Institution : 
Novosibirsk State Tech. Univ., Novosibirsk, Russia
         
        
        
        
        
        
            Abstract : 
The novel points of view to the formation of shaped charge jets are described. The physics of so-called hypercumulation are described in details and confirmed by numerical simulations. It has been shown that hypercumulation effects allow to increase both the speed and mass of a cumulative jets much more than the theory by Lavrentyev-Birkhoff predict. The applications of novel effects are the oil-well perforations.
